## Database Connection Pooling

The Vantrell API tier uses a shared pooler (Quillpool) sitting between app nodes and the primary Postgres cluster. Pool size is capped at 40 per node; exhaustion shows up as `pool_wait_timeout` errors in the Harbinger dashboard. Do not raise the cap without checking replica lag first. Restarting Quillpool drains connections gracefully and is safe during business hours. For escalations beyond a restart, reach the data-platform rotation at the address below.

escalation mailbox, hadug-bajog: sormir@norvalabs.internal

HANDOVER — Commission Scheme Revision

To the incoming director: the revised scheme goes live on the 1st. Key changes: accelerators start at 110% of quota, not 100%; multi-year Quillstone deals pay out over term, not upfront; clawbacks extend to nine months. Reps were briefed last week — expect pushback from the Ashgrove pod. Payroll mapping is done; Tomas owns the calculator. Disputes route through RevOps, not you. One outstanding item: the enterprise override rate is unresolved. Background for that decision sits below.

internal memo for kahif-kawig: Project Fravan slips by two quarters because of the tooling delay.

Escalation: notification fan-out backpressure. If queue depth on Fanline exceeds 50k for 10 minutes, pause the Petrel digest producers first. Do not restart workers mid-drain. If depth keeps climbing after 20 minutes, page the messaging lead and hold the release. For anything beyond a one-hour stall, escalate to the platform duty owner at this address.

alerts address for bawif-hahig: norwyn_gorys_lamath@olvarqlabs.test